I just installed CentOS4 on my main server. It runs proftpd and is not NATted.. When I did the install I said to allow FTP and HTTP. I can ftp from windows dos ftp client. In IE I get "Unable to build data connection: No route to host" ncftp I get.. Data connection timed out. Falling back to PORT instead of PASV mode. List failed. Wget and FireFox just time out. Anything I need to add to the firewall rules? This is all it has related to FTP. -A RH-Firewall-1-INPUT -p tcp -m state -m tcp --dport 21 --state NEW -j ACCEPT
